Some films at the Cleveland International Film Festival are emotional, some are educational and some are simply funny. Awful Nice is one of those comedies this year. The film is about two brother's, Jim and Dave who have lost touch with each other but are reunited after the death of their father. "Jim is a college professor with a wife and family, while Dave lives off the grid in a wigwam."
They decide to try to fix up their father's old lake house together but end up fighting for most of the time. Jim and Dave are in completely different places in their lives and it's extremely hilarious to watch them interact while trying to accomplish something.
